WebTrifasciata laurentii or "Mother-in-Law's Tongue". This is the most famous and easily recognised of all the Sansevierias. Traditionally it was used as a striking background for smaller plants with flowers or ferny foliage. WebA general rule to find the right size pot for snake plants is to go for a pot that is 1/3 the size of the roots in both length and width. For fast-growing plants, you can get a pot 2-4 inches bigger. For slow-growing plants, a 1-2 inches bigger pot. Overall, 8-12 inch pot will work just fine. Different species needs different pot size.
